Article: Brookstone 'Tie Died' Campaign Seeks to Take Dangerously Obsolete Father's Day Gifts Off the Streets in Exchange for 10 Percent Store Discount.

Promotion follows voluntary disbandment of necktie trade group

MERRIMACK, N.H., June 5 /PRNewswire/ -- Recognizing that a zero-tie Father's Day could finally be within reach, Brookstone today announced a campaign to give customers instant 10 percent savings for turning in a men's necktie to any Brookstone store.

Beginning today and running until Father's Day, June 15, Brookstone's Tie-Died promotion will take 10 percent off an entire purchase for customers who bring a necktie to any one of the chain's 318 stores nationwide.
